High Speed PET Stretch Blow Molding Machine , 1.25 Litre Bottle Blowing Machine
- Performance and Characteristics
- The servo motor has been adapted to the moulding mechanism, triggering off a bottom mold linkage as well. The whole works with speed, accuracy, stability and flexibility. The servo motor is energy saving and safe for the environment.
- Heated by oil or electricity, bottles will not deform at the temperature of 92℃, stilling qualified for the hot filling standard. Each cavity an reach to the average output of 1000 bph.
- The whole blowing process works more efficient, flexible with the aid of the servo motor driven stepping unit and stretching mechanism.
- The length of the preforms ensure sufficient units heated within the same distance without interruption.
- The thermostatic heating system ensure that the heating temperature of each preform surface and internal is uniform.
-
- Hinged oven holders make it easy for the operators to change infrared tubes and do maintenance.
- The high pressure blowing system is also equipped with the gas recycling device (air recycling rate can be up to 30%)which may reduce power consumption as much as 30kw per hour.That means you do not need the low pressure air compressor any more, which will minimize your investment as well as the space for placing the machine. In one word, it is energy-efficient and environmental safe.
- The simple slide-in way of mold mounting makes it possible for the operators to change molds easily within 30 minutes.
- The man-machine interface is highly automated and easy to operate. The compact machine occupies a smaller area.
- This series is applied widely in PET hot filling bottle for juice, tea drinks ,energy drinks and other hot filling drinks.
